WebThe harbor (or harbour) seal ( Phoca vitulina ), also known as the common seal, is a true seal found along temperate and Arctic marine coastlines of the Northern Hemisphere. The most widely distributed species of … WebOct 12, 2024 · The seals appear tan, brown, gray, or silvery white with characteristic V-shaped nostrils. An adult harbor seal can measure 6.1 feet. Harbor seals commonly inhabit rocky areas to avoid predation and …

Harbor seal pups are able to swim within hours of being born and can often be seen resting along the coast and sandy beaches. The pups weigh between 8-26 lb when at the time of birth.

WebThe two most common seals are gray and harbor seals. Gray seals are much larger than harbor seals, and the males and females look quite different. Adult males can weigh up to 800 pounds (females are about half that). Harbor seals, in comparison—both male and female—only weigh about 200 pounds.
